Bowerbirds @ Lincoln Hall

Following an energetic set by opening band Dry The River, I sensed some disjointedness as the Bowerbirds began their headlining performance at Lincoln Hall on 3/29. The stage was somber - in mood and lighting. The first few songs seemed hurried; Beth switched from keys to accordion as if it was a game of "capture the flag." Phil Moore sang in his own timing, as the percussion rushed the songs into an abrupt ending.
Eventually, seemingly after realizing how loyal and forgiving the fans were, all five members of Bowerbirds loosened up. Backing up Beth Tacular and Moore was a demure cellist, drummer and bassist. Each of the members' faces was still and tranquil as the enchanting harmonics of Beth's voice soothed the rugged tenor of her counterpart - and real-life love - Philip Moore.
Phil, as lead vocalist and guitarist, did not say much between songs. He mentioned that he was from Iowa, almost begrudgingly; some audience members cheered while others empathized. "I have not been happy playing a show every night for months straight, but tonight - here in Chicago - I am happy," Phil said with sincerity.
At least a half a dozen times during the bucolic and joyous set, they mentioned the recent release of their latest record, The Clearing, as if to forewarn the audience that they may not recognize the sound. In fact, it was not the popular track "Northern Lights" off their debut album Upper Air that riled up the crowd the most, but a simple and elegant song titled "Stitch The Hem" from The Clearing that excited people most.

Bowerbirds are set to release their new LP titled The Clearing, on March 6th via Dead Oceans.
The Clearing is more than a third record for the Bowerbirds. Between 2009's Upper Air and this one, Beth nearly died after a mysterious illness that put her in the hospital. They rescued and adopted a dog that ran beneath their tour van's tires. Beth and Phil even ended their long relationship but began it again after realizing that, despite their own shortcomings, they didn't want to be with anyone else. Mostly, though, they returned to their cabin in the woods of North Carolina to nest--to make soup and walk dogs, to make art and write songs, to realize that this was their life and find contentment in it. For the Bowerbirds, The Clearing represents the perfect realization of a fresh, timely outlook.Download the album's first single "Tuck The Darkness In" via BrooklynVegan.
